Overall, each analysis should touch on the various activity components, any areas of occupation, client factors, activity demands, performance skills and patterns, and contexts and environments.

The general factors for an activity analysis are: activity name and description. supplies and space needed with any noted special considerations. any preparation work that is needed. determine the relationship the activity has with a major life occupation and/or role. age and gender appropriateness.

Today, the activity analysis process has been refined to include physical, perceptual, cognitive, psychological, social and cultural factors.

-- Step 1: Determine what is being analyzed -- Step 2: Determine the relevance and importance to the client: occupation-based activity analysis -- Step 3: Determine the sequence and timing -- Step 4: Determine object, space, and social demands -- Step 5: Determine required body functions -- Step 6: Determine required ...

The goal of activity analysis is to identify the specific physical, cognitive, and social components of an activity and to evaluate how well an individual can complete each component.

Activity analysis forms are a tool used by a recreational therapist to determine the inherent requirements placed on the participant of an activity physically, cognitively, socially and emotionally.

Activity Analysis (AA) can be used to document anything that a person does while performing a task. There are two purposes for AA: to determine the activities that occur in any situation, and how often the activities are performed.
